SELEUCID KINGDOM. Antiochus IX Eusebes Philopator (Cyzicenus) (114-95 BC). AR tetradrachm (29mm, 16.62 gm, 10h). NGC AU 5/5 - 5/5. Antioch on the Orontes, first reign, spring/summer 113 BC-spring/summer 112 BC. Diademed head of Antiochus IX right with short, curly beard; bead-and-reel border / BAΣIΛEΩΣ / ANTIOXOY | ΦΙΛΟ-ΠΑΤΟΡΟΣ, Athena standing facing, head left, resting left hand on grounded shield, spear resting against arm, Nike in right hand facing left, crowning wreath border; NT monogram above A in outer left field, N in inner right field. SC 2363.b.

From the Medicus Collection. Ex Hess Divo, Auction 320 (26 October 2011), lot 240.
